Default Clearview 8 inch with recurve

I just bought and installed the Clearview 8 inch with recurve.
I was wondering if the HD three pouch would fit, or hang over the windshield some.

If you have a picture of the two or three HD pouch with this windshield I'd appreciate a view.

I haven't gotten it out on the freeway yet but hope I got the right height.
I'm 5' 9" and when back and forth over the 8 in verses 9.5 inch.

What height are you and size of windshield.

It will fit. I have the 6.5" recurve and it fits just fine with the single wide pouch version...the Clearview is the same as the stocker until the last 1-2 inches.

I have the harley 3 pouch bag with my 8" clearview. I don't have a pic right now, but it works fine. The upper corners on the extreme outside do stick out a fraction of an inch past the windshield, but not enough to even notice it.
